GSF Car Parts is seeking a Warehouse Controller in Chelmsford to lead a team of Warehouse Operatives and ensure the smooth operation of the warehouse.
Key responsibilities include:
- Managing stock control
- Overseeing the Goods In and Out processes
- Developing the team
Ideal candidates will have:
- A proven track record in warehouse management
- Strong leadership skills
- The ability to work under pressure
The role offers competitive benefits including performance bonuses, annual leave days, and professional development opportunities.
